Analysis
In 2024, % of homicides of non-white children and adolescents aged 10 to 19 in Panama stood at 93.9.
That represents a change of down 0.6% on the previous year and down 1.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, % of homicides of non-white children and adolescents aged 10 to 19 in Panama peaked at 96.6 in 2021 and was at its lowest, 90.5, in 2022.
% of homicides of non-white children and adolescents aged 10 to 19 in Panama,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 92.2 | — |
| 2011 | 93.2 | +1.1% |
| 2012 | 93.9 | +0.8% |
| 2013 | 94.5 | +0.6% |
| 2014 | 95.7 | +1.3% |
| 2015 | 94.9 | -0.8% |
| 2016 | 94.5 | -0.4% |
| 2017 | 93.7 | -0.8% |
| 2018 | 95.3 | +1.7% |
| 2019 | 93.4 | -2.0% |
| 2020 | 94.1 | +0.7% |
| 2021 | 96.6 | +2.7% |
| 2022 | 90.5 | -6.3% |
| 2023 | 94.5 | +4.4% |
| 2024 | 93.9 | -0.6% |
